Transaction 5b439b82ce9a3968354bc25ff178b73bece1bf285c65e25252da5be63a7e73ef

1 Input
2 Outputs
  • 5b439b82ce9a3968354bc25ff178b73bece1bf285c65e25252da5be63a7e73ef:0
  • value  49087895
    address  3CDcEWkJaFieH5eamUVAPb7axwL6veiRXv
  • 5b439b82ce9a3968354bc25ff178b73bece1bf285c65e25252da5be63a7e73ef:1
  • value  126537
    address  3FhTryrUKyTAn2Ay5hcPVQ4xyT9KAGZ2aM